BMI View: Real estate related loans on Japanese banks balance sheets have seen relatively slow growth compared to the growth in portfolio assets, a trend that we expect to reverse over the medium term. With the IPD rental index returning to positive growth territory for the first time in 29 months, real estate could present itself as a more attractive investment compared to government bonds.
